"Bulbs packed with PertoTec’s innovative film prevents dehydration"

Consumers buy flower bulbs for their gardens to enjoy the beautiful flowers. Therefore it’s necessary that those bulbs remain fresh. Just like fruits and veggies, flower bulbs also need to be fresh in order to ensure bloom.

PerfoTec visited some French garden centers to see how Lily bulbs perform after transport from Holland. To transport bulbs from grower to consumer, it’s crucial that bulbs do not sprout or dehydrate too much before being planted in consumers' gardens.

With the PerfoTec Fast Respiration Meter, the respiration of Lily bulbs was measured. This is important to know how to micro perforate the packaging. Some Lily bulbs were packed with normal packaging and some Lily bulbs were packed and micro-perforated with PerfoTec special innovative film.

The results were good. When other Lily bulbs from competitors were already sprouted, the Lily bulbs with PerfoTec technology were still fresh. Microperforated packaging is important to prevent sprouting. Bulbs packed with PertoTec’s innovative film prevents dehydration.
